The new musical ¡Americano! tells the true and inspiring story of Tony Valdovinos an undocumented immigrant growing up in Phoenix, Arizona. Tony is inspired by the events of 9/11 to serve in the Marines and his childhood and high school years are focused on the singular goal of enlisting on his 18th birthday. But when he tries, Tony discovers he is an undocumented immigrant, a Dreamer. With grit, determination, and help from his family and community, Tony discovers a new mission: one that can make history, create more good, and inspire more change than he ever could as a Marine.
